Don't know much about the place, but this bowling alley has the last 24 pinsetting machines of its kind - IN THE ENTIRE WORLD.
These are apparently called "Bowl Fast" pinsetters, manufactured by Simmons Machine Tool Corporation in Albany, NY, for Bowling Machines Inc, a now defunct company.
They're unique because the setting table comes down before the pins are placed in the bins, instead of after, like what is normally done with those Bowl-Mor machines you find in most candlepin bowling alleys nowadays. The pins drop in with a loud THUD which rumbles the whole floor. Apparently you can feel it standing at the end of the lane.
